Creating an onyx landscape can be quite the investment, but let me break it down for you. Depending on where you live and the scale of your project, costs can vary significantly. First off, you have to consider the price of onyx itself. This beautiful stone can range from about $50 to over $200 per square foot, depending on the quality and sourcing. If you’re going for a luxury look, you'll definitely feel that pinch in your wallet.
Next up are installation costs. Hiring a professional is vital to ensure everything looks seamless, and that's where the expenses can really climb. Labor rates vary, but you might be looking at anywhere from $60 to $100 per hour. And don’t forget about preparation work! If the site requires extensive excavation or grading, that can add hundreds or even thousands to your bill.
Lastly, maintaining an onyx landscape can also affect long-term costs. Regular cleaning and, in some cases, sealing will ensure that the stone remains sparkly and safe from deterioration over time. All in all, if you plan carefully, the beauty of an onyx landscape can truly justify the costs, bringing a unique flair to your outdoor space!

The beauty of onyx lies not just in its appearance but in how it interacts with light and the surrounding landscaping elements. First and foremost, regular cleaning is crucial. Dust, dirt, and debris can dull the enticing sheen of onyx. I usually recommend a simple mix of warm water and a mild soap to gently scrub the surface. Just make sure to rinse thoroughly; leaving soap residue can lead to stains.
In addition, sealing your onyx can help it maintain its luster. Depending on the type of onyx, you might want to apply a sealant every couple of years. This protective layer safeguards against moisture and stains, ensuring that each piece retains its vibrant colors. Don’t forget about keeping the surrounding plants well-trimmed—their overgrowth can cast shadows on your onyx, disrupting the beautiful natural light it captures. And of course, when seasons shift, be proactive. If you anticipate heavy rain or snowfall, clearing the area of leaves and debris helps maintain that pristine aesthetic, which is the essence of onyx.
